SMBIOS (System Management BIOS) defines a standard way for system firmware to expose hardware and system information to operating systems and management tools. The SMBIOS 2.7 update refines and extends that standard to improve hardware reporting, management, and compatibility with modern systems. This post explains the key changes, practical impacts, and what system builders, IT pros, and developers should do.

The primary function of SMBIOS is to provide a standardized data structure that the OS can query to learn about the computer’s capabilities. Before standards like SMBIOS were widely adopted, managing diverse hardware configurations was a chaotic process for operating systems. The SMBIOS 2.7 update, released by the Distributed Management Task Force (DMTF), refined this structure significantly. By introducing stricter definitions for existing data structures and expanding the "Processor Information" type, it allowed for better differentiation between physical and logical processor cores. This granularity was essential as multi-core processors became the industry standard, ensuring that software could accurately distinguish between a dual-core chip and a single-core chip with hyper-threading, thereby optimizing resource allocation.
